Song choice


 
We have chosen to use this cover of Ed Sheeran's I See Fire, as we really liked the acoustic song, sub-genre Pop Acoustic, and Ed Sheerans style. However, our main character will be a female solo singer, therefore we needed a female voice. Our performer will lip sync to this cover, instead of the original to ensure the mouth movements match the exact song.
